    How Much Are House Removal Costs In Surrey?

    The house removal costs in Surrey are £1,228, according to our latest data.

    The cost of moving largely depends on the size of the home and the distance between properties, but the day of the week can also have an impact. The average lowest cost of moving in the area sits at £802, with the highest average at £1,653.

    What is The Best Time of Year To Move in Surrey?

    Our research shows that August is the most popular month to move house in Surrey, with over 11% of removals occurring during this time. It’s not surprising that summer is the most popular time of year to move as the longer days and brighter sunlight makes for the perfect conditions.

    Summer is such a popular time of year in fact, that August is also the most favoured month to move throughout the whole of the UK. This time of year provides plenty of free time with school holidays, better weather and lighter days to help you through the process.     Agreeing with the general UK population, winter is the least popular time to move house in Surrey. February had the lowest percentage with only 6.1% of removals having been booked during that specific month. There may be less competition during winter, but don’t forget to factor in the cold, dark days and the chance of bad weather disrupting your removal.

    What is The Best Day Of The Week To Move In Surrey?

    Friday is the most popular day to move house in Surrey. A total of 29% of our users chose to move on the gateway to the weekend, ensuring they had two more days to recover from the chaos and unpack their belongings.

    With the return to work too close for comfort, Sunday is the least popular day to move with only 4.1% of movers choosing this day of the week.

    However, if you want a cheaper removal quote and less competition, you may want to consider moving on a Sunday if the disruption isn’t too extreme for your upcoming working week.

    • London

      With the highest percentage of home moves, London is the most popular place to move amongst our Surrey users. This is unsurprising due to the higher salaries and variety of job opportunities. However, London’s current average house price is £798,758, which is slightly more expensive compared to Surrey’s average of £600,814.

    • Woking

      Woking is next on our list with an average house price of £530,857. It’s a perfect area for those wishing to commute to London as the journey to Waterloo Station takes approximately 24 minutes.

    • Crawley

      Another popular town for commuters, Crawley’s current average house price is much cheaper at £327,614. Gatwick Airport is also situated close by for those wishing to travel even further.

    • Guildford

      With an average house price of £563,170, Guildford is another popular destination for Compare My Move’s Surrey movers. There is a range of job opportunities to explore in this area, particularly for those looking to work within the video game production industry.

    • Burpham

      A suburb of Guildford, Burpham is first on our list with a current average asking price of £526,552. With Guildford Castle and the River Wey both situated nearby, it’s an entertaining and family-friendly area with lots to explore.

    • Redhill

      With easy access to Gatwick Airport and a variety of bus routes, Redhill is a great location for commuters and the current average asking price is only £416,520. Redhill is home to a variety of good schools and offers an array of properties to choose from.

    • Addlestone

      Addlestone is next on our list of areas with affordable housing, with an average asking price of £415,403. Previously mentioned in H.G Wells' book, ‘The War of the Worlds’, it’s a town rich with history and culture.

    • Byfleet

      Located east of Woking, Byfleet is a quaint village with a current average asking price of £416,836. There are plenty of different property types available, suitable for all personalities and tastes.
